Photo ID 242891 by Andrei Shmatko. Russia Navy Ilyushin IL 38, RF 75342
Cross Data Search
Photo ID 242891 by Andrei Shmatko.
Ilyushin
Ilyushin IL-18/20/22/24/38
Ilyushin IL-38
Russia - Navy
Russia
Off-Airport - Vladivostok
June 19, 2020
June 22, 2020
RF-75342
082011208
70 RED
Andrei Shmatko
Spy Planes & Reconnaissance
Open in parent new window.
Close window